Hello Everyone,

For QC purposes, there are a couple of methods to both qaulitatively and quantitatively inspect your manufacturing process.

For Paste inspcetion, an inline machine like the SE300 by CyberOptics may be appropriate. You may also incorporate inspection on the Screenprinters themselves as this is an option that can be found on the MPM screenprinters.

You can also implement Automated On-Line Inspection(AOI)by incorporating component placement inspection both prior to reflow (CyberOptics provides the KS-50) and as a post reflow inspection method (CyberOptics provides the KS-100).

You may find yourself needing to utilize X-ray inspection, typically off-line for qualitative analysis of BGA's, etc. Genrad-Nicolet is the largest provider for these systems.
